2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o vs. 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E
To start off,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o would be higher. At 6,200 cc (8 cylinders), 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E (397 HP @ 5700 RPM) has 197 more horse power than 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o. (200 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E should accelerate faster than 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E weights approximately 1124 kg more than 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E is all wheel drive (AWD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E (565 Nm) has 260 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o. (305 Nm). This means 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Chevrolet Monte Carlo | 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E | |
Make | Chevrolet | Cadillac |
Model | Monte Carlo | ESCALADE |
Year Released | 2005 | 2013 |
Body Type | Coupe |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3786 cc | 6200 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 200 HP | 397 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5700 RPM |
Torque | 305 Nm | 565 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 97 mm | 103 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86 mm | 92 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.4:1 | 10.4 |
Drive Type | Front | AWD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 7 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1470 kg | 2594 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5030 mm | 5144 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1840 mm | 2007 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1410 mm | 1928 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2720 mm | 2947 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 7.8 L/100km | 13 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.8 L/100km | 18 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 9.8 L/100km | 15.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 64 L | 98 L |
